Connecting to Salesforce APIs with Apigee using JWT auth. and mutual TLS

Hey All,

I've written a step-by-step tutorial for how to talk to the Salesforce APIs with mutual TLS (mTLS). In this article I explain how to setup an Apigee shared flow that uses the Salesforce OAuth 2.0 JWT Bearer Flow to obtain an access token. I also show a sample proxy that makes use of this shared flow to invoke the Salesforce SOQL API.
